4.2 Market Drivers |
4.2.1 Increasing demand for high-efficiency solar cells and LEDs, where GaAs wafers are utilized due to their superior properties. |
4.2.2 Growing adoption of GaAs wafers in wireless communication applications, such as 5G networks, due to their high frequency capabilities. |
4.2.3 Technological advancements in GaAs wafer production processes leading to improved quality and cost-effectiveness. |
4.3 Market Restraints |
4.3.1 High initial investment required for setting up GaAs wafer manufacturing facilities. |
4.3.2 Limited availability of gallium resources, which can impact the production of GaAs wafers. |
4.3.3 Competition from alternative materials like silicon that offer lower costs but may not match GaAs performance in certain applications. |
